About A Project

I'm working on a big project called Trojan- A Star Trek Fan Production. This project is very ambitious and time consuming, so I need more content for my YouTube channel in between projects. This next project is recreating various episodes from the classic and original Scooby-Doo series, Scooby-Doo Where Are You! These episodes will be shorter than the original episodes. The original episodes are around 20 minutes long, while my version will be only 5-10 minutes long. This will be achieved by speeding up the animation speed or frame rate and editing out any unnecessary dialogue. There are a total of 25 episodes from the Scooby-Doo Where Are You! Series. 17 Episodes in the first season and 8 episodes in the second season. There was a third season of Scooby-Doo Where Are You!, but I don't really count it because it was made several years later and it has various other distinctive factors that make it differ or contrast from the original series.
